Prologue (1969 film)

Prologue is a 1969 National Film Board of Canada feature from Robin Spry, shot and set in Montreal and Chicago, blending drama with documentary sequences from the 1968 Democratic National Convention protests. == Plot == Jesse (John Robb) edits and sells an underground newspaper on the streets of Montreal.
